OREANDA-NEWS. On 12 January 2009 was announced, that the Belarusian government approved the package of measures developed by the Agriculture Ministry to promote farm production for 2010, a source in the administration of the country told.

Grain output is expected at 10 million tonnes in 2010, meat output at 1.5 million tonnes, and milk output at 8 million tonnes.

Fertilizer application is expected at 292 kilograms per hectare in 2010, including 97 kilograms of nitrogen fertilizers, 78 kilograms of phosphate fertilizers and 117 kilograms of potash fertilizers.

The measures will be approved by a special resolution of the government, which will also envisage liability of authorities for failure to meet the targets.
